The work ethics that are monitored are as follows: attendance, character,
teamwork, appearance, attitude, productivity, organizational skills,
communication, cooperation, and respect. Work ethics will be evaluated by
the following method. Remember, to meet expectations is a good thing. In
the workforce as well as in college most people fall in the category of 2meets expectations. Attached is the TCSG evaluation form that will be used.

There is a procedure for appeal in place for the work ethics program. It is as
follows:
1. If the student does not feel that the evaluation he or she received is
justified, the student should put the appeal in writing to the instructor.
2. If the student is not satisfied with the results received from the
instructor, he or she may appeal to the Program Manager.
3. If the student is not satisfied with the results from the Program
Manager, he or she may appeal to the Dean.
4. If extenuating circumstances warrant further investigation, a final
written appeal should be submitted to the Work Ethics Coordination
Monitors.
5. NOTE: All appeals must be in writing.

Attendance: Attends class; arrives/leaves on time; notifies


instructor in advance of planned absences.
Character: Displays loyalty, honesty, trustworthiness,
dependability, reliability, initiative, self-discipline, and selfresponsibility.
Teamwork: Respects the rights of others; respects confidentiality;
is a team worker; is cooperative; is assertive; displays a customer
service attitude; seeks opportunities for continuous learning;
demonstrates mannerly behavior.
Appearance: Displays appropriate dress, grooming, hygiene, and
etiquette.
Attitude: Demonstrates a positive attitude; appears self-confident;
has realistic expectations of self.
Productivity: Follows safety practices; conserves materials; keeps
work area neat and clean; follows directions and procedures; makes
up assignments punctually; participates.
Organizational Skills: Manifests skill in prioritizing and
management of time and stress; demonstrates flexibility in handling
change.
Communication: Displays appropriate nonverbal (eye contact,
body language) and oral (listening, telephone etiquette, grammar)
skills.
Cooperation: Displays leadership skills; appropriately handles
criticism, conflicts, and complaints; demonstrates problem-solving
capability; maintains appropriate relationships with supervisors and
peers; follows chain of command.
Respect: Deals appropriately with cultural/racial diversity; does not
engage in harassment of any kind.
